Well we are getting close to the tax filing deadline (sixteen days from today!) Just remember that one thing you may qualify for to reduce your 2014 income tax is make a traditional IRA contribution up until April 15, 2015 (one of the few after-the-fact tax saving ideas allowed.) See more information at this tip from the IRS below: http://content.govdelivery.com/accounts/USIRS/bulletins/fbb96b?reqfrom=share If you qualify you can contribute $5,500 if you are single ($6,500 if you are over 50.) If you are married you may be able to double this amount. A great way to save for retirement and use tax savings to help pay for it. Musings of a Burbank CPA: Most Suspicious IRS Audit Triggers
What are some items on your tax return that could ‘red flag’ it by the IRS for audit? The Minnesota Society of CPAs has made a list of things that could cause the Service to take a closer look at your tax return: http://www.accountingtoday.com/gallery/photos/most-suspicious-irs-audit-triggers-74055-1.html?utm_campaign=daily-mar%2020%202015&utm_medium=email&utm_source=newsletter&ET=webcpa%3Ae4039805%3A2498807a%3A&st=email Now, just remember that having these items will not automatically get you an examination letter. These are just risk factors; the more of them there are, the larger the POSSIBILITY the IRS may assign a live person to inspect your return in more detail, then determine if it is worth it to them to audit the return. If you have a legitimate deduction and can document it, by all means you should take the deduction (but you may not want to risk an audit for a few hundred dollars in tax savings.)
